Supporting the Social Enterprises Ecosystem, Hyundai Motor Group Launches Hyundai Start-up Challenge Indonesia 2021

instellar
11 November 2021

Hyundai Motor Group officially launches Hyundai Start-up Challenge Indonesia 2021.Hyundai Start-up Challenge Indonesia 2021 is an accelerating program and challenge competition which aims to discover and nurture young social entrepreneurs with innovative ideas and creative solutions to education, employment, and environmental problems.This is the 2nd program where Hyundai Motor Group successfully initiating Hyundai Start-up Challenge Indonesia 2020 last year. Promotion of Hyundai Start-up Challenge Indonesia 2021 was conducted by Hyundai Motor Group through Hyundai Motor Manufacturing Indonesia together with

the Ministry of Tourism and Creative Economy and participants of Baparekraf for Startup (BEKUP) on Monday, 10th of May 2021 in Mulia Hotel Jakarta. The event was attended by Muhammad Neil El Himam, Deputy Chairman of Digital Economy and Creative Products, Selliane Halia Ishak, Director for Digital Economy Governance, and Kanghyun Lee, Vice President of Hyundai Motor Manufacturing Indonesia. 

Hyundai Motor Group will work with Impact Alliance, Crevisse, Instellar, and Indonesia Creative City Network in managing Hyundai Start-up Challenge Indonesia 2021. Hyundai Start-up Challenge Indonesia 2021 itself is a commitment of Hyundai Motor Group in supporting the development of social enterprises in Indonesia. Carrying the slogan of “The Better, The Bigger Impact”, Hyundai Motor Group stimulates the knowledge and skills of young social entrepreneurs to deliver a bigger impact for Indonesian people through their respective business.

Hyundai Start-up Challenge Indonesia 2021 will select 15 teams where each team will receive a $6,500 grant to develop their business during the program. Each team will also get interactive business classes and expert mentors during the acceleration phase. The Demoday and Awarding ceremony in October 2021 will be the final phase of Hyundai Start-up Challenge 2021 where top 3 performing teams will be selected as the winners and are eligible to receive a total prize of $45,500 as well as an opportunity to pitch their business in South Korea.
